Biography
Ms.
Han-Ralston practices in the areas of international
transactions, business transactions, real estate
transactions, and estate and tax planning. She has
been actively involved in the business community and
the Asian community of the Tampa Bay, Florida. Her
achievements have been featured in the Tampa Bay
Business Journal, the Maddux Business Report, the
2007 Tampa Bay Corporate Guide (an annual
publication of Tampa Bay Partnership) and other
media. Ms. Han-Ralston was awarded the 2007 Business
Woman of the Year for the International Category by
the Tampa Bay Business Journal. She is a frequent
speaker on issues relating to doing business with
China.
